Handover for contractors using the Pellbrook Campus shuttle-bus gate: the gate now opens only from the keypad, as the motion sensor was disabled last week after repeated false triggers. Wait for the shuttle fully inside the yellow line before opening, and confirm the barrier closes behind you. The keypad accepts the following pass code.

badge for fafop-fajof: bdg-Z-47

## Idempotency Keys for Payment Retries

The Tollgate payments worker at Brindlewood retries failed charges up to three times. Each retry reuses the idempotency key derived from the order UUID plus attempt window, so duplicate charges are impossible as long as the key-signing secret is consistent across all worker pods. If keys drift between pods, the processor treats retries as new charges. Rotation requires a full worker restart, never a rolling one. Add the following line to the worker's environment file before restarting.

sealed setting: LEDGER_TOKEN29=130a4f7ada97c8be1e00128e577ab

## Formula sandbox tuning

User-supplied formulas in Gridmoor execute inside a restricted interpreter with hard ceilings on time, memory, and call depth. Reviewers should confirm any change to these ceilings is justified in the PR description, since raising them widens the abuse surface. Defaults were chosen from production traces. The current limits are as follows.

limits module of tafog-fawip:
WEIGHTS = {
    "julix": 57,
    "lamys": 992,
    "kasvan": 209,
    "quenok": 750,
    "alddor": 259,
    "oliath": 1009,
    "wenix": 815,
}

Handover for the Keyhollow password reset revamp: the new token flow is live in staging but not prod. Marit verified expiry handling; throttling still needs a soak test. Please watch the reset-queue depth after deploy, since retries spiked last Tuesday. The staging service currently runs with these configuration values.

service settings:
PRAIX_LOG_LEVEL=error
PRAIX_METRICS_HOST=metrics.praix.qorvelcorp.corp
PRAIX_POOL_SIZE=16